We recognize the importance of creating a work environment that is both rewarding to our employees and supportive of our unwavering commitment to provide unparalleled service to our clients.PurposeHold a key leadership position, responsible for providing strategic direction, technical oversight, and mentorship to the instrumentation and control engineering discipline. Contribute to the organization's engineering strategies, drive innovation, and ensure excellence in the execution of instrumentation and control engineering projects.ResponsibilitiesPerform equipment sizing & selection, alternative analyses, and other deliverables.Support the engineering, design, procurement, construction, and commissioning of facilities.Present engineering and design deliverables to project members, cross‑functional teams, senior leadership, external vendors, clients, and other stakeholders.Plan, forecast, and actualize deliverable progress to support project reporting and schedule requirements.Identify scope changes and estimate impact to effort and schedule.Supports proposal efforts by evaluating RFP scope, identifying list of deliverables, and estimating effort required.Work is highly independent.Prepare, review, and approve instrumentation equipment, conduit, and wiring calculations, requisitions, lists, studies, reports, BOMs, and designs.Develop Operating Controls Philosophy and Cause & Effect Diagrams, review HMI layout and Network Architecture Diagram.QualificationsBachelor's degree in Engineering.Seven or more (7+) years of relevant experience.Professional Engineer (PE) license preferred.Extensive knowledge and experience in instrument and controls engineering principles and practices.Advanced proficiency in engineering software and tools for system design, simulation, and analysis.Ability to interpret and create technical drawings, schematics, and specifications.In‑depth understanding of process control systems and automation technologies.Strong knowledge of industry codes, regulations, and best practices.Ability to develop and implement instrumentation and control engineering standards and guidelines.Proficient in both written and spoken English.CompetenciesEffective working relationships with internal leaders and peers, as well as external clients.Highly motivated and problem‑solving attitude.Effective verbal and written communication skills.Strong work ethic and commitment to quality.Self‑reliance and ability to operate independently with limited direction.Strong marketing/business development skills and mindset.Commitment to promoting the reputation of the company through quality of work.Aspirations to grow professionally and advance within the company.Commitment to driving profitability and growth.Commitment to becoming a “citizen” of the broader organization, breaking down barriers and silos.Commitment to working in partnership with others inside and outside the organization.Ability to effectively manage multiple time‑sensitive tasks.Focus on improving return on investment.Basic understanding of financial reports and metrics.Data analysis and interpretation skills.About BowmanAre you ready to build a career that makes a lasting impact?
